Pet's info: Cat | Ocicat | Female | unspayed | 3 years and 8 months old | 6 lbs
I brought my cat to the vet two weeks ago and was given amoxicillin for a UTI without a urine test as her bladder what empty. Last night she pooped in the corner and it had a lot of mucus with red in the mucus. She had also puked up her cat food several times in the past two days. Is any of this related or of cause for concern?

Usually not and these signs could be actually related to a gastrointestinal infection/inflammation. It is indeed possible that the UTI is due to stress secondary to the gastrointestinal problem, which is the primary problem to be solved or it may be that the antibiotics are upsetting her stomach. Another check up is indeed required if the sign do not resolve with few days of a bland diet based on boiled chicken or white fish and rice in small portions given 3 or 4 times daily for a week.
